Key Components and ⁣Functionality of HID Ballast Wiring

HID (High-Intensity Discharge) ballast wiring ​is an essential part of any lighting system ​utilizing HID lamps. Understanding the⁣ is crucial for achieving optimal performance and longevity of ​your lighting setup. By ‍connecting‌ the various components in the correct manner, HID ballast wiring ensures a stable power supply and facilitates the ignition and operation of HID lamps.

At its core, HID ballast wiring consists of three key components: the ballast, the capacitor, and the ignitor. The ballast‌ serves as the power regulator, providing the necessary voltage and current ⁤to ignite the lamp and maintain its operation. The capacitor acts as a temporary energy storage device, releasing a burst ⁤of energy to ignite the lamp.‍ Lastly, the ignitor generates a high-voltage pulse to initiate the arc within the lamp. By working together, these components enable HID lamps​ to achieve their characteristic⁣ bright and efficient illumination, making them ideal for a wide range of applications.

Q: What is a ballast in ‌the context of HID lighting?
A: The ballast is​ a critical component of High-Intensity⁣ Discharge (HID) lighting ‍systems, responsible for regulating the‌ flow of ⁢electrical current ⁣and providing the necessary voltage to ignite and maintain the arc inside the bulbs.

Q: What are the basic components of a typical HID ballast?
A: A typical ‍HID ballast consists of several key components, including the igniter, capacitor, transformer, ‍and the necessary wiring ‍connectors. Each component plays a crucial role in ensuring the proper functioning of the ​lighting system.

Q: Can you briefly⁤ explain the purpose of the igniter?
A: The igniter serves the essential purpose of ‌initiating⁣ the electrical ⁢discharge inside the HID bulb. Once the ballast supplies enough‌ voltage, the igniter generates a high-intensity ‌pulse to ⁢trigger the⁢ initial⁣ arc, which then produces the​ desired bright light.

Q: ‍How does the capacitor contribute to the​ HID ballast operation?
A: The‍ capacitor in an HID ballast helps maintain a stable voltage supply by storing and releasing electrical energy as needed. It acts as a buffer to compensate for rapid fluctuations in current,‍ ensuring a ⁣consistent output and preventing damage to the ballast ⁤or bulb.

Q: What role does the transformer play in HID lighting systems?
A: The transformer in an HID ballast ‌is responsible for converting the input voltage into the appropriate output voltage⁤ required to ignite and sustain the arc inside the bulb. It efficiently steps up or steps down the ⁣electrical supply to match the specific needs of the HID lighting system.

Q: Are there any precautions to consider when ​working with HID ballasts?
A: Yes, ​there are a ⁤few precautions to consider when working with HID ballasts. Firstly, always ensure power is disconnected before making any connections or modifications. Secondly, handle the ballast with care, avoiding any physical damage or exposure to heat. Lastly, follow the manufacturer’s guidelines and local electrical codes for a safe and compliant installation.

Q: Can an HID ballast be compatible with different types of HID bulbs?
A: HID ballasts are typically designed to support specific bulb types and wattages. While some ballasts may be compatible with multiple bulb⁣ variations, it is essential to consult the ballast’s ⁤technical specifications or the manufacturer’s recommendations to ensure compatibility before installation.
